Icon B2C Customer Segments

In the B2C segment, Public Bank focuses on individuals across different demographics. A significant portion of its customers includes middle to high-income earners, such as salaried employees, professionals, and retirees. The bank provides a comprehensive suite of financial products, including savings accounts, loans, and investment options. Public Bank also targets younger demographics with digital banking solutions and entry-level financial products.

Icon B2B Customer Segments

For its B2B segment, Public Bank offers extensive commercial banking services to SMEs and large corporations. SMEs are a crucial segment, with offerings like business loans and trade finance. Larger corporations utilize Public Bank for more complex financial services, including corporate finance and treasury services. The bank's focus on SMEs supports their growth, which is a key driver of the Malaysian economy.

Where does Public Bank operate?

The geographical market presence of Public Bank is primarily centered in Malaysia, where it has a strong foothold and extensive branch network. The bank's operations are deeply rooted in the Malaysian market, ensuring accessibility across all states. Key urban areas like Kuala Lumpur, Selangor, Penang, and Johor Bahru are major markets, contributing significantly to the bank's retail and commercial banking activities.

Beyond Malaysia, Public Bank has a strategic international presence, particularly within the ASEAN region. Its international operations are focused in countries such as Hong Kong, Cambodia, Vietnam, Laos, and Sri Lanka. These international ventures support the bank's growth and diversification, complementing its strong domestic base.

The bank's approach to market entry and expansion is often driven by trade linkages and investment flows within the region, supporting its Malaysian corporate clients expanding overseas while capturing local market opportunities. This strategic approach helps Public Bank maintain a balanced and diversified portfolio, contributing to its overall financial performance.

Icon Malaysia's Dominance

Public Bank's main market is Malaysia, where it has a broad network of branches. This extensive reach ensures that the bank can serve a diverse range of bank customers across the country. The bank's strong presence in major urban centers like Kuala Lumpur and Penang allows it to capture a significant portion of the nation's financial activity.

Icon ASEAN Expansion

Public Bank has a strategic focus on the ASEAN region, with key markets including Hong Kong, Cambodia, Vietnam, Laos, and Sri Lanka. These international operations support the bank's overall growth. The bank's international operations contributed 7.9% to the Group’s pre-tax profit in 2023.

Icon Hong Kong Operations

In Hong Kong, Public Bank operates through Public Bank (Hong Kong) Limited, focusing on retail and commercial banking. This strategic presence leverages Hong Kong's status as a global financial hub. This allows the bank to provide sophisticated financial products to a diverse clientele, catering to their specific needs.

Icon Cambodia's Presence

Public Bank has a significant footprint in Cambodia through Cambodian Public Bank Plc. (Campu Bank). Campu Bank has grown to be one of the largest foreign-owned banks in the country. It caters to both local and expatriate communities, emphasizing accessible banking services and financial literacy programs.

How Does Public Bank Win & Keep Customers?

The bank's approach to acquiring and keeping customers involves a mix of traditional and digital strategies, along with a strong focus on building relationships and loyalty. For acquiring new customers, the bank uses traditional advertising methods such as television, radio, and print, especially for products like savings accounts and basic loans. Simultaneously, digital marketing plays an important role, with targeted campaigns on social media platforms, search engine marketing, and email marketing to reach specific groups within the customer demographics. Strategic partnerships, such as collaborations with property developers for housing loans or automotive dealers for hire purchase financing, are also used to bring in new customers. The extensive branch network remains a key point for direct customer interaction and product sign-ups.

Customer retention strategies focus on building long-term relationships and increasing customer lifetime value. The bank emphasizes personalized customer experiences, using customer data and CRM systems to understand individual needs and offer tailored financial solutions. This includes proactively offering product upgrades, wealth management advice, and customized loan options. Loyalty programs often provide preferential rates for long-standing customers or exclusive access to new products. The bank's strong emphasis on customer service, both at branches and through its call centers, is a key retention driver, addressing customer queries and resolving issues efficiently. After-sales service, particularly for loans and insurance products, is crucial for maintaining customer satisfaction and trust.

Over time, the bank has adjusted its strategies to align with technological advancements and changing customer behaviors. The shift towards digital banking has led to increased investment in mobile banking applications and online self-service portals, reducing the need for physical branch visits for routine transactions. This digital transformation has also enabled more data-driven marketing campaigns, allowing for more precise targeting and higher conversion rates. The bank continually monitors customer feedback and market trends to refine its acquisition and retention initiatives, aiming to improve customer loyalty and reduce churn rates, ultimately contributing to sustained growth in its customer base and profitability.
